USPS says it will resume accepting inbound packages from China, Hong Kong

  • The United States Postal Service announced it will resume accepting international packages from China and Hong Kong after a brief suspension.
  • The USPS is collaborating with Customs and Border Protection to manage the new tariffs from China effectively.
  • China's Ministry of Finance announced economic measures against the U.S., including tariffs on natural gas and coal.
  • President Donald Trump cited illegal immigration and drug trafficking as reasons for imposing tariffs on Chinese imports.
